Types of Door Locks

Before setting out to install new locks, it's important to understand the different types offered. Each type serves various purposes and comes with its special features. Here's a table summarizing some common lock types:

Lock TypeDescriptionBest ForDeadboltA high-security lock that needs a crucial or thumb turnExternal doorsKnob LockA lock integrated into the door knobInterior doorsLever Handle LockEasy to use, typically discovered in commercial and residential homesInterior and commercial doorsPadlockA portable lock with a shackle that can secure gates, sheds, and lockersShort-term securingSmart LockA digital lock that uses smartphones or codes for entryModern homes with innovative security systemsWhy Install New Door Locks?

The Installation Process

Setting up a new door lock might seem difficult, especially for those without prior experience. Nevertheless, with a little persistence and the right tools, it can be a straightforward process. Here's a step-by-step guide:

Tools Needed

  • Screwdriver (flathead and Phillips)
  • Tape procedure
  • Chisel
  • Drill
  • Level
  • Pencil

Installation Steps

  1. Select the Right Lock: Based on the kind of lock, ensure it fits your door (thickness and pre-drilled holes).

  2. Get Rid Of the Old Lock:

    • Use a screwdriver to eliminate the screws holding the existing lock in place.
    • Thoroughly pull the lock out of the door.
  3. Procedure for Proper Fit:

    • Use a tape measure to check the distances for the new lock, ensuring it's compatible with any existing holes.
  4. Set Up the New Lock:

    • If the new lock requires a larger hole, utilize a drill and chisel to create the essential area.
    • Insert the new lock into the door, aligning it with the holes.
    • Secure it in location utilizing screws.
  5. Set Up the Strike Plate:

    • Hold the strike plate in its corresponding position on the door frame.
    • Utilize a pencil to mark the screw holes, drill holes, and attach the strike plate.
  6. Test the Lock:

    • Check the positioning by turning the key and unlocking.
    • Make certain the lock operates smoothly; readjust if needed.
  7. Replace Doorknob or Handle: If installing a knob or handle, follow a comparable treatment, guaranteeing it lines up correctly with the lock.

Maintenance Tips

Once set up, routine upkeep of door locks is necessary for optimal efficiency. Here are some tips for keeping your locks in good condition:

  • Lubricate Periodically: Use a graphite-based lube on locks every 6 months to make sure smooth operation.
  • Inspect Alignment: Regularly inspect that the lock is still aligned correctly with the strike plate.
  • Check for Wear and Tear: Address any signs of rust, deterioration, or damage. This can be an indication that a replacement is required.
  • Change Batteries: For smart locks, consistently examine and change batteries to prevent being locked out.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. How often should I change my door locks?

It is advisable to change door locks every 5 to 7 years or instantly if you encounter security issues, such as losing a key or experiencing a burglary.

2. Can I install a smart lock on my existing door?

The majority of smart locks can be installed on existing doors; nevertheless, guarantee compatibility with your door type and structure.

3. What is the best lock for security?

Deadbolts are considered one of the most secure kinds of locks, particularly if coupled with a strong door and quality strike plate.

4. Do I require to work with an expert for installation?

While property owners can install locks themselves with some basic tools, employing an expert makes sure that the locks are set up properly, improving security.

5. What should I do if my lock is jammed?

If a lock jams, try lubing it with graphite. If problems continue, consider calling a locksmith for support.
